Who studying biochemistry?

Students studying biochemistry typically learn about the chemical processes and principles underlying biological systems, such as metabolism, genetics, and molecular biology. They may also explore advanced topics like protein structure, enzyme kinetics, and bioinformatics. Biochemistry students often conduct laboratory research to gain hands-on experience in these areas.


Biochemistry is the branch of natural science or medical science?

Biochemistry is a branch of science that explores the chemical processes within and related to living organisms. It intersects both natural and medical sciences by studying the molecules and chemical reactions underlying biological processes. By understanding these mechanisms, biochemistry helps explain how organisms function and develop, and contributes to fields such as medicine, nutrition, and biotechnology.


Why is biochemistry important?

Biochemistry is important because it helps us understand the chemical processes that occur within living organisms. It provides insights into how cells function and interact with each other, which is crucial for fields such as medicine, agriculture, and biotechnology. By studying biochemistry, we can develop new treatments for diseases, improve crop yields, and design innovative biotechnological solutions.

What is nanotechnology in biochemistry?

Nanotechnology in biochemistry involves manipulating and studying biological molecules at the nanometer scale. It allows for precise control and manipulation of biomolecules for various applications, such as drug delivery, imaging, and biomaterial development. Nanotechnology in biochemistry has the potential to revolutionize healthcare and advance our understanding of biological systems at the molecular level.


Why is biochemistry called the chemistry of life?

Biochemistry is called the chemistry of life because it is the study of the chemical processes and substances that occur within living organisms. It focuses on understanding the molecular mechanisms that drive essential biological processes such as metabolism, growth, and reproduction. By studying biochemistry, scientists can uncover the fundamental principles that underlie life itself.
